Ikermiut is a former settlement inAvannaata municipality in northwesternGreenland. It was located onIkermiut Island in the center ofInussulik Bay, a bay in the northern part ofUpernavik Archipelago.[2] The settlement was abandoned in 1954 in favor of more northerly settlements ofNuussuaq andKullorsuaq, due to rough sea waves of Inussulik Bay overflowing the island.[1]
